Medical facility bed rental can be a wonderful option for family members that anticipate requiring a healthcare facility bed for less than 20 weeks. Renting out does not need you to have the overall amount of the bed up front, and might conserve you money gradually if the patient's needs are reasonably brief. Some distributors will certainly likewise attribute component of your rental expense toward the eventual acquisition click to read more of the bed.
Investing in a medical facility bed is typically the most effective option if you anticipate requiring it long-lasting - Hospital Beds For Home Use. Despite the first price, it might end up being more affordable in the future if you need it for greater than 20 weeks. The various other primary benefit of acquiring a bed is the ability to tailor it to much better fulfill the client's and caretaker's requirements

Electric beds enable the client to manage the position and height of the bed with a push-button control (Hospital Beds For Home important source Use). Unlike with a manual bed, this provides the person control over the bed so they do not have to rely on a caregiver to make modifications
Depending on the design of the bed, some electric beds may offer a variety of settings. While an electrical motor increases and reduces the head and footrest of the bed, a caregiver changes the elevation of the bed with a crank. This causes a "halfway" choice that enables loved one individual independence at a reduced cost.
A hand-operated bed can work well for people who don't need a great deal of modification, but clients will usually have much less freedom.
